How to Approach the Question
  • First, carefully examine the unfolded 2D net of the cube provided in the question.
  • Identify the pairs of opposite faces. A simple rule is that in a straight strip of faces, alternate faces are opposite. The two faces on the flaps are also opposite each other.
  • Systematically analyze each of the four answer options (the folded 3D cubes).
  • For each option, check if any of the visible adjacent faces correspond to a pair you identified as opposite.
  • The cube that shows two opposite faces touching each other is the one that cannot be formed and is the correct answer.
  • Remember the question asks which cube CANNOT be made, so you are looking for the impossible configuration.
